If you're someone who thrives on solving problems, crushing goals, and growing in your career—this is your kind of team.What You’ll Be DoingAs a Capacity Sales Associate, you’ll play a critical role in connecting available trucks with customer freight. You’ll build relationships with transportation partners, negotiate competitive rates, and help ensure shipments move efficiently and on time.This is a fast-paced, entry-level sales role designed for driven individuals who want to develop strong negotiation skills and build a career in logistics.Daily Responsibilities:Negotiate competitive freight rates with transportation partnersCoordinate shipments to help ensure timely pickup and deliverySupport pricing strategies and account planning alongside your teamAssist in resolving transportation challenges quickly and professionallyBuild and maintain relationships with a network of reliable carriersDevelop an understanding of freight lanes, geography, and market trends over timeWork toward individual and team performance goalsApply feedback from leadership to continuously grow your skillsCommunicate clearly with drivers, customers, and internal teamsPartner with Driver Services to support tracking and compliance effortsHelp verify carrier information to maintain service qualityEscalate challenges appropriately while learning company processesWhat You Bring to the TableBachelor’s degree preferred (all majors welcome)Internship, campus leadership, athletics, or customer-facing experience is a plusStrong communication skills — written and verbalCompetitive mindset and willingness to learnHigh attention to detail and strong organizational skillsAbility to multitask in a fast-paced environmentComfort working toward performance goalsProficiency in Google Workspace or Microsoft Excel (advanced functions are a plus but not required)What You’ll Get in ReturnCompetitive base salary plus commissionA clearly defined career path with tiered promotions tied to performance milestonesStructured onboarding and hands-on trainingCareer advancement opportunities — we promote from withinPaid holidays and PTO (starting after 90 days)Health, dental, and vision insurance401(k) retirement planA supportive, team-oriented, high-energy office environmentDog-friendly office
